The article discusses how the new Trionda soccer ball used in the 2026 World Cup affects gameplay, particularly goalkeeping performance. Manufacturers designed it with a four-panel construction and deep seams to enhance flight stability and grip. Experienced goalkeepers have struggled with its speed and trajectory, leading to an increase in goals scored outside the box and errors resulting in goals, highlighting the ball's impact on match outcomes.
